coryne, A Silver membership is just a General Admission type of membership, so there is no designated seat allocations this Year..


The General admission seats at the MCG are located on Level 3, right at the top... You can enter from any Gate.... However, there is a catch to it.....


the MCG has a General admission area on Level 1, which are really Great seats but you have to turn up early...6pm will do it....

The First Area is at the Ponsford Stand, Aisles M28 & M29.... Enter from Gate 1

the Second area is at the Olympic Stand, Aisles M55 & M56, Enter Gate 3



Sometimes, one of those areas becomes a reserved seating depending on how many tickets have been Sold, but Ask them at the Ground when you get there and they will tell you....
